构建、合规与未来展望

比特币作为首个去中心化数字货币,其“挖矿”过程(即通过算力竞争验证交易并生成新区块)一直是行业核心议题,而比特币挖矿机网站作为连接矿工、矿机厂商与市场的桥梁,其源码的开发与合规性备受关注,本文将从挖矿机网站的核心功能、源码技术架构、合规风险及未来趋势展开分析,为相关从业者提供参考。

比特币挖矿机网站的核心功能定位

比特币挖矿机网站并非简单的“矿机销售平台”,而是集矿机参数展示、算力收益计算、实时行情监控、矿池对接、社区交流于一体的综合性服务系统,其核心功能包括:

  1. 矿机数据库:展示不同品牌(如比特大陆、嘉楠科技、神马矿机等)矿机的算力(TH/s)、功耗(W)、能效比(J/TH)、价格等参数,支持按预算、算力需求筛选。
  2. 收益计算器:结合比特币全网算力难度、电费成本、矿池手续费等动态数据,实时计算矿机的日收益、回本周期及净利润。
  3. 行情与监控:对接比特币价格、挖币难度、全网算力等API,提供实时数据;同时支持矿机接入监控平台(如AntPool、F2Pool),远程查看矿机运行状态。
  4. 矿池推荐与对接:根据矿机类型、地理位置推荐低费率、高稳定性的矿池,并提供矿池配置教程。
  5. 用户社区与资讯:发布挖矿行业动态、政策解读、技术教程,搭建矿工交流社区。

挖矿机网站源码技术架构解析

挖矿机网站源码的开发需兼顾高性能、实时性、安全性,常见技术架构如下:

前端技术栈

  • 框架:React/Vue.js(组件化开发,提升用户体验)
  • UI组件库:Ant Design、Element UI(快速构建专业界面)
  • 数据可视化:ECharts/D3.js(展示算力难度趋势、收益曲线等)
  • 实时更新:WebSocket(对接比特币价格、算力等实时数据)

后端技术栈

  • 语言与框架
    • Java(Spring Boot:稳定、生态成熟,适合高并发场景)
    • Python(Django/Flask:开发效率高,适合快速迭代)
    • Node.js(Express:轻量级,适合实时I/O密集型应用)
  • 数据库
    • 关系型数据库(MySQL/PostgreSQL):存储用户信息、矿机参数、订单数据等结构化数据;
    • 非关系型数据库(Redis):缓存热门数据(如比特币价格、算力难度),提升访问速度;
    • 时序数据库(InfluxDB):存储矿机运行状态、历史算力等时间序列数据。
  • API对接
    • 币价API:CoinGecko、CoinMarketCap;
    • 矿池API:主流矿池开放接口(如AntPool的Stratum协议);
    • 区块链浏览器API:Blockchain.com、Blockchair(获取全网算力、难度数据)。
  • 随机配图